Webb16 apr. 2024 · The octet rule states that atoms tend to form compounds in ways that give them eight valence electrons and thus the electron configuration of a noble gas. An … Webb10 okt. 2024 · The octet rule refers to the tendency of atoms to prefer to have eight electrons in the valence shell (outer orbital). When atoms have fewer than eight electrons, they tend to react and form more stable compounds. When discussing the octet rule, we do not consider d or f electrons.

Webb2 nov. 2016 · The octet rule states that atoms tend to gain or lose electrons in their outer levels until they acquire eight electrons and are then unreactive. Ultimately, the atoms become more stable if they can get a full energy level. Helium has a full energy level with 2 electrons so it doesn't follow the octet rule.
